Automated Marketplace Order Tracking in Odoo

Customer Overview

Parnells, a leading European seller of tyres, car parts, and a wide range of other products, faced challenges tracking sales across multiple marketplaces like Amazon, eBay, and ChannelEngine. They needed a solution to automatically tag orders by marketplace to improve reporting, analysis, and decision-making.

Challenge

With orders coming from multiple platforms, Parnells struggled to:

  • Identify which marketplace each sale originated from
  • Compare marketplace performance efficiently
  • Reduce duplicate effort in reporting

Solution Overview

Parnells requested a powerful new feature in our apps — Automatic Partner Tagging at the Sales Order Level when an order is committed from ChannelEngine, eBay, or Amazon.

To address this, our team:

  • Gathered requirements and analysed existing business processes
  • Designed a tagging workflow and finalised it with customer approval
  • Implemented the solution within their Odoo system

Now, when orders are imported or synced from Amazon, eBay, or ChannelEngine, the system automatically assigns partner tags at the order level. These tags integrate with Sales, Website, POS, and Reporting.

Configurations

We provided Parnells with a configuration screen to define partner tags for eBay, ChannelEngine, and Amazon.

Tags can be set country-wise or by sub-marketplace, enabling flexible tracking across multiple marketplaces.

For Amazon Orders

Go to Amazon App > Amazon Marketplaces, where partner tags can be set for each country-specific marketplace.

For eBay Orders

Go to eBay App > eBay Instances, where partner tags can be defined for each instance.

For ChannelEngine Orders

Go to ChannelEngine App > Channel Name (Marketplace Name), where partner tags can be set for each channel instance.

How to Use

Each Sales Order includes a “Partner Tags” field, with the ability to assign multiple tags per order.

Partner tags are visible in the Sales Orders list and pivot views, and grouping by partner tags provides marketplace-level insights.
